In this method, the vector is introduced into cut stems or leaves to transiently express a cell division-promoting factor along with Cas9\/gRNA. This approach successfully induces mutations in planta, allowing for the simple generation of genome-edited crops from regenerated shoots.<br \/>\nThis technique bypasses the need for conventional transformation and tissue culture and can be applied to a broad range of plants amenable to Agrobacterium-mediated gene transfer, including the Solanaceae, Asteraceae, Cucurbitaceae, and Fabaceae families. It is expected to enable the efficient production of genome-edited individuals and extend the application of genome editing to plants that have been traditionally difficult to modify.<\/p>\n<h3>Data<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li><strong><em>In planta<\/em> genome editing in soybean<\/strong>: The system was used to target GmPPD1 and its homolog GmPPD2, which are involved in photoperiodism and flowering time. Diverse mutations, including insertions, deletions, and substitutions, were confirmed in the target sequences. These mutations were inherited by the T1 generation, where phenotypic changes such as enlarged leaves were also observed (Figure).<\/li>\n<li>Genome editing was also successfully used to target the GmFAD2 and GmFAD6 genes to suppress the synthesis of linoleic acid, a compound responsible for the &#8220;beany&#8221; flavor in soybeans.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<table style=\"border-collapse: collapse; width: 50.5%; height: 129px;\">\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td style=\"width: 100%;\"><a href=\"http:\/\/bionauts.jp\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/10\/WL-04918a_lower_EN.png\"><img decoding=\"async\" loading=\"lazy\" class=\"alignleft wp-image-4849 size-medium\" src=\"http:\/\/bionauts.jp\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/10\/WL-04918a_lower_EN-300x254.png\" alt=\"\" width=\"300\" height=\"254\" srcset=\"https:\/\/bionauts.jp\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/10\/WL-04918a_lower_EN-300x254.png 300w, https:\/\/bionauts.jp\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/10\/WL-04918a_lower_EN.png 550w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 300px) 85vw, 300px\" \/><\/a><\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<h3>Publication(s)<\/h3>\n<p>Yata.
